Abstract
Pulsed fiber laser spectral beam combining is demonstrated using spatial-dispersion-free approach based on 1nm-sharp spectral-edge filters. Three beams separated spectrally by ~2nm are combined with >90% efficiency yielding 52-W combined power and 1.9-mJ combined energy.
